Popular Indiana Eatery Serves The ‘Best Barbecue’ In The Entire State

A beloved barbecue restaurant in Indiana is gaining fresh national attention as diners and food critics continue praising its slow-smoked meats and welcoming atmosphere. Big Hoffa’s Smokehouse and Tavern has become one of the most talked-about barbecue destinations in the state, attracting visitors from across Indiana and beyond.

Known for its tender brisket, smoky pulled pork, and fall-off-the-bone ribs, the Westfield smokehouse has built a loyal following through traditional barbecue techniques, generous portions, and a relaxed tavern experience. Why Food Lovers Are Talking About Big Hoffa’s

What began as a local neighborhood barbecue spot has evolved into one of Indiana’s standout food destinations. Customers regularly highlight the restaurant’s deep smoky flavors, balanced seasoning, and authentic low-and-slow cooking methods.

The restaurant’s smoked meats are prepared using carefully selected wood blends that create a rich flavor profile without overpowering the meat itself. Diners also praise the variety of house-made sauces, which range from tangy vinegar-based options to sweeter barbecue blends with molasses notes.
